Output edfcfbc5c9b84b71a91cec9caebe66abc4eccc5b39de0b75dabd3c2decc80bd7:75

value
196654
script pubkey
OP_0 OP_PUSHBYTES_32 8b19c4d01d94622ab35e3e7e516879c75897dfb9e45f0a3f25af1bda71cfb6b2
address
bc1q3vvuf5qaj33z4v678el9z6recavf0haeu30s50e94uda5uw0k6eq35y0a0
transaction
edfcfbc5c9b84b71a91cec9caebe66abc4eccc5b39de0b75dabd3c2decc80bd7
confirmations
1124
spent
true